How Much Mortar Do I Need for CMU Blocks?

The amount of mortar required depends on:

  • Wall size
  • Block size
  • Mortar joint thickness
  • Masonry pattern
  • Construction waste

For standard:

8x8x16 CMU blocks

a common estimate is:

One 80 lb mortar bag covers approximately 35 CMU blocks


Basic Mortar Estimation Formula

The general formula is:

Total Blocks ÷ Coverage Per Mortar Bag

Example:

210 blocks ÷ 35 = 6 bags

Estimated mortar needed:

6 mortar bags


Mortar Bags for Common Wall Sizes

Wall SizeApproximate BlocksMortar Bags Needed
100 sq ft113 blocks4 bags
200 sq ft225 blocks7 bags
300 sq ft338 blocks10 bags
500 sq ft563 blocks17 bags

These estimates may vary depending on mortar joint thickness and construction methods.


60 lb vs 80 lb Mortar Bags

Mortar bags are commonly sold in:

  • 60 lb bags
  • 80 lb bags

80 lb Mortar Bags

Most commonly used for CMU walls

Advantages:

  • Better coverage
  • Fewer bags required
  • Preferred by contractors

Coverage:

Around 35 CMU blocks per bag


60 lb Mortar Bags

Smaller and lighter bags are easier to carry but provide less coverage.

Coverage:

Around 25–27 CMU blocks per bag


Mortar Joint Thickness

Standard mortar joints are usually:

3/8 inch thick

Thicker joints require:

  • More mortar
  • Higher material cost

Consistent mortar joints improve wall appearance and structural performance.


Factors That Affect Mortar Usage

Several factors can increase or decrease mortar requirements.


Block Size

Larger blocks may require more mortar depending on joint design.


Wall Complexity

Walls containing:

  • Corners
  • Openings
  • Decorative patterns
  • Reinforcement

usually require additional mortar.


Masonry Skill Level

Experienced masons typically waste less mortar during installation.


Weather Conditions

Hot weather may cause mortar to dry faster, increasing material usage.

Mortar Types for CMU Construction

Common mortar types include:

  • Type M
  • Type S
  • Type N

Type M Mortar

Used for:

  • Foundations
  • Heavy loads
  • Retaining walls

Provides high compressive strength.


Type S Mortar

Very common for:

  • Structural walls
  • Exterior masonry
  • CMU block walls

Offers strong bonding and durability.


Type N Mortar

Commonly used for:

  • Interior walls
  • Light-duty construction
  • Non-load-bearing applications
